Understanding Society’s Standards for Single Women

Societal Pressure to Settle Down

As a single woman, you may feel the weight of societal pressure to settle down, get married, and start a family by a certain age. This pressure can come from family members, friends, and even the media, which often portrays marriage as the ultimate goal for women. However, it’s important to remember that your worth is not defined by your relationship status and that there is no one-size-fits-all timeline for finding love.

Stigma of Singledom

In some cultures and communities, being a single woman past a certain age can carry a stigma. You may feel judged or pitied by others who believe that there must be something wrong with you if you’re still single. It’s essential to challenge these outdated stereotypes and embrace your single status as a time for self-discovery and growth.

Questioning Self-Worth

Society’s obsession with romantic relationships can lead single women to question their self-worth and value. You may start to feel inadequate or incomplete without a partner, leading to feelings of loneliness and insecurity. It’s crucial to remember that you are whole and deserving of love, whether you’re single or in a relationship.

The Importance of Self-Love for Single Women

Embracing Independence

Being single offers a unique opportunity to embrace your independence and prioritize self-care. This can include pursuing your passions, traveling solo, or simply enjoying your own company. By cultivating a strong sense of self-love, you can build a fulfilling and meaningful life on your own terms.

Setting Boundaries

Self-love also involves setting boundaries with others and honoring your own needs and desires. As a single woman, you have the freedom to choose what you want in a relationship and what you’re willing to compromise on. By establishing healthy boundaries, you can protect your emotional well-being and practice self-respect.

Self-Exploration and Growth

Singlehood is a time for self-exploration and personal growth. Take this opportunity to focus on your own development, whether that’s through furthering your education, pursuing a new hobby, or working on your mental health. By investing in yourself, you can become the best version of yourself and attract positive and fulfilling relationships in the future.

FAQs

1. How can I combat feelings of loneliness as a single woman?

Combat loneliness by connecting with friends and family, joining social groups, and engaging in activities that bring you joy and fulfillment.

2. Is it okay to prioritize self-love over finding a partner?

Absolutely! Prioritizing self-love is essential before entering into a healthy and fulfilling relationship with another person.

3. How can I challenge societal norms and expectations as a single woman?

Challenge societal norms by standing firm in your beliefs, setting boundaries with others, and embracing your unique journey and path in life.

4. What are some self-care practices I can incorporate into my daily routine?

Self-care practices can include meditation, exercise, journaling, spending time in nature, practicing gratitude, and engaging in creative pursuits.
